Output 1abf39b920733db503ce173b91ba18d1b3c0f48860ca8dc3c85e8b761d06521c:57

value
540232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faeaa431cefbd7f772e905c9903aa9d212c58af6 OP_EQUAL
address
3QZjwfrAT6DGTeDpDqxdbhyfxcTN17gz6K
transaction
1abf39b920733db503ce173b91ba18d1b3c0f48860ca8dc3c85e8b761d06521c
spent
true